Chatsworth man arrested for DUI after failing to move over for emergency vehicle in Dalton

According to a Dalton Police Department incident report, On June 18th, 2023, Officer Ruiz assisted Lt. Cantrell with a traffic stop on West Waugh St and Hamilton Street with a 2018 Honda Civic. Lt. Cantrell advised that the driver, identified as Bradley Dewayne Phillips, 36, of Chatsworth, seemed to be impaired. Officer Ruiz reported, “While [I] spoke with Bradley, [I] could smell the odor of an alcoholic beverage on his breath. In addition, Bradley’s speech was very slow and lethargic. At times, it seemed as if it took Bradley a few seconds to understand what [I] was saying.” During field sobriety tests, Bradley showed several signs of impairment and was placed under arrest for DUI. Bradley agreed to the state test and was transported to the Whitfield County Jail, where he showed a BrAC of .124. Bradley was charged with DUI and failure to move over for emergency vehicles.
